LendingTree puts mortgage shopping inside ChatGPT
LendingTree launched a ChatGPT plug-in that lets consumers begin mortgage shopping through ChatGPT rather than its own site or a lender’s digital funnel. It is a concrete distribution shift: a major US financial-services marketplace is treating the AI assistant as a customer-acquisition interface for a regulated lending journey.

DeepSeek’s open V4-Flash now delivers frontier agent performance at sharply lower API cost
DeepSeek launched the public beta of V4-Flash 0731, added Responses API compatibility and Codex support, and released the weights under an MIT license. Artificial Analysis reported a jump from 40 to 50 on its index—one point behind GPT-5.6 Luna Max—while DeepSeek priced it at $0.14 per million input tokens and $0.28 per million output tokens, with a 98% cache-hit discount. The release also improved its banking-agent benchmark score by eight points.

Databricks makes Unity AI Gateway generally available for enterprise agent governance
Databricks made Unity AI Gateway generally available as a control layer for models, agents, MCP servers, skills and tools. It centralizes access controls, usage monitoring and spend management—capabilities that become harder to bolt on once multiple business units deploy agents across several model providers.
